I’ve been buying Kindle books for years, and the refund policy is one of those things you learn the hard way. Amazon does allow refunds for Kindle books, but there’s a catch—it’s not a free-for-all. You usually have seven days to request a refund, and it’s mostly meant for accidental purchases or if the book is legitimately defective. I once tried returning a book just because I didn’t vibe with the writing style, and it worked, but I’ve heard others say they got denied. It seems like Amazon’s algorithm flags accounts that refund too often, so you gotta be careful.

The process is pretty straightforward though. You go to your order history, find the book, and click ‘Return for refund.’ No need to explain yourself, but if you abuse it, they might cut you off. I’ve noticed they’re stricter with newer accounts or frequent refunders. Also, if you’ve read past a certain percentage of the book, they might reject the request. It’s not like a physical book where you can flip through and decide—once you’ve dug deep into a Kindle book, they assume you’ve ‘consumed’ it. So my advice? Sample first, buy second, and only refund if it’s a real issue.

Can I return a kindle book for refund if I didn't like it?

9 Answers2025-07-20 12:41:25
I've had my fair share of hits and misses with digital books. Amazon actually has a pretty straightforward return policy for Kindle books, but there are some key details to keep in mind. You can return a Kindle book within seven days of purchase if you haven't read more than 10% of it. The process is simple - just go to your Amazon account, find the order, and select 'Return for refund'. However, I've noticed Amazon keeps an eye on frequent returns. If you're returning too many books in a short period, they might restrict this option for you. It's not meant to be a 'try before you buy' service, but rather a safeguard against accidental purchases or genuinely unsatisfactory content. For books I'm unsure about, I often use the 'Send a free sample' feature first, which lets me read the first few chapters before committing.

How to refund a Kindle book purchased as a gift?

11 Answers2025-07-28 00:57:18
Refunding a Kindle book purchased as a gift involves a few steps, but it’s straightforward if you know where to look. First, the recipient of the gift needs to initiate the refund since the book is tied to their account. They can go to 'Manage Your Content and Devices' on Amazon, locate the book, and select 'Return for Refund.' The refund will go back to the original payment method. If the recipient hasn’t opened the book yet, the process is smoother, as Amazon’s policy allows refunds within seven days of purchase for unread titles. However, if they’ve already started reading, it might be trickier, but customer service can sometimes help. I’ve found Amazon’s support to be pretty accommodating if you explain the situation politely. Just remember, the refund timeline can take a few days to process, so don’t panic if it doesn’t show up immediately.
